We have a requirement, where in we need to run the same workflow in parallel for different set of records at the same time. PS: both users need to run same workflow for both eg: user 1 needs to run workflow 1 for his own set of records user 2 also needs to run workflow 1 for his own set of records at the same time. We plan to invoke INFA through pmcmd. Is it possible to achive the same in INFA 8. If so , how. As we understand this was not possible in 7.

How read it for version 8: Use the concept of concurrent workflows.Using pmcmd and using different parameter files we can achieve this. In workflow you need to enable the configure concurrent execution tab.Define each workflow instance name and configure a workflow parameter file for the instance. You can define different sources, targets, and variables in the parameter file. In monitor you can see same workflow running with different instance name: wf_sales [Instance1] wf_sales [Instance2] wf_sales [Instance1] wf_sales [Instance2] So the syntax is: pmcmd startworkflow [<-folder|-f> folder] [<-startfrom> taskInstancePath [<-recovery|-norecovery>]] [<-paramfile> paramfile] [<-localparamfile|-lpf> localparamfile] [<-osprofile|-o> osProfile] [-wait|-nowait] [<-runinsname|-rin> runInsName] workflow here [<-runinsname|-rin> runInsName] is the intance name which you need to pass while calling the pmcmd for diff instances. varun sharma Solutions

Run workflow in parallel First of all, let me clarify - this option is available harshaarepalli123
146 posts since Feb 11, 2011

only in version 8.6 and higher. In order to run the same workflow parallely(concurrent Workflows): 1. Enabale the concurrency in workflow properties(Workflow Menu-->Edit-->Enable concurrent workflow execution --> Allow concurrent run only with unique instance) 2. Create Instance in the workflow properties and specify individual parameter files for each instance. RUNINSTANCE1=param_1 RUNINSTANCE2=param_2 3. Use can have shell script to create the above parameter files in runtime. 4. Informatica will create runid and append date and time stamp for all the log files it creates.
